◉ Acetaminophen (Tylenol). Answer: Uses: mild to moderate pain,
fever
SE: hepatotoxicity with higher doses
Education: patient should not exceed 4g daily, antidote is
acetylcysteine
◉ Opioid Agonists. Answer: -Morphine, Fentanyl, Dilaudid,
Oxycodone
-Uses: moderate to severe pain, sedation
-Mode of action: bind to opioid receptors in CNS
SE: slow everything down (sedation, gi upset, res. depression,
constipation)
Key Points: antidote is naloxone, monitor pain level, assess pain
before and after, administer slowly, have pt increase fluid and fiber
intake
◉ Opioid Antagonists: Naloxone. Answer: Uses: opioid overdose
(reverses analgesia)
,SE: speeds everything up (hypertension, tachycardia, agitation, gi
upset)
Key points: monitor pain and res. status (res greather than 12)
◉ Broad-spectrum antibiotics:. Answer: Effective against wide
variety of bacteria (kills good & bad bacteria)
◉ Narrow-spectrum antibiotics:. Answer: effective for certain
strains
◉ Bactericidal antibiotics. Answer: kill the bacteria
◉ Bacteriostatic antibiotics. Answer: slow the growth of the bacteria
to allow the immune system to finish the work
◉ Penicillins. Answer: -Penicillin, Amoxicillin, Piperacillin
Tazobactam
-Uses: bacterial infections
-MOA: weaken cell wall causing death of cells
-SE: gi upset, allergic reaction (dyspnea, rash, hives), renal toxicity
-Contraindications: pts with allergy to penicillins or cephalosporins
,◉ Cephalosporins: Cephalexin, Cefazolin, Ceftriaxone. Answer: -
Uses: bacterial infections
-MOA: weaken the cell wall causing death
-SE: gi upset, allergic reaction, superinfection (cdiff or yeast
infection)
-Contraindications: pts with allergy to penicillins or cephalosporins
-Education: no alcohol consumption, given with food to prevent GI
upset
◉ Carbapenems: Imipenem-Cilastatin. Answer: -Uses: broad
spectrum, bacterial infections
-SE: gi upset, rash, superinfections
-Contraindicted in pts with allergy to pencillins or cephalosporins
◉ Vancomycin. Answer: -Uses: very serious infections and antibiotic
associated C.diff
-MOA: destroys cell wall causing death
-SE: auto toxicity, renal toxicity, infusion reactions (phlebitis, Red
Man Syndrome)
-Key Points: administer through PICC line for long-term use, monitor
trough and peak levels (very narrow therapeutic range!!), monitor
creatinine levels for renal toxicity
◉ Antitumor Antibiotic: Doxorubicin. Answer: -Uses: solid tumors
, -MOA: binds to DNA and inhibits DNA/RNA synthesis causing death
of dividing cells
-SE: gi upset, cardiac toxicity, alopecia, bone marrow suppression
(causing anemia, neutropenia), red discoloration of urine, sweat &
tears
-Key Points: monitor for s/s of infection, administer antiemetics,
monitor CBC & cardiac function
◉ Antimitotic Medication: Vincristine. Answer: -Uses: variety of
tumors/cancers
-does not cause bone marrow suppression!!!
-MOA: stops cell division during mitosis
-SE: peripheral neuropathy (tingling and numbness), phlebitis at IV,
gi upset, alopecia
-Key Points: administer antiemetics, monitor for s/s of neuropathy,
use central line or PICC to prevent phlebitis
◉ Alkylating Agent: Cyclophosphamide. Answer: -Uses: variety of
tumors/cancers
-MOA: inhibits protein synthesis
-SE: bone marrow suppression, gi upset, alopecia, hemorrhagic
cystitis (damage to lining of bladder)
-Key Points: increase fluid intake (2-3L), monitor urine for blood,
monitor CBC and administer antiemetic
